Transaction 5d3cf9a50fd84566350ddcc5bee4da46fbc80fceb650085f7fefdcbf2b968f9d
1 Input
1 Output
-
5d3cf9a50fd84566350ddcc5bee4da46fbc80fceb650085f7fefdcbf2b968f9d:0
- value
- 24959293
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7d3017ece90f9274abfc265d4c1c9c37e6fb3ce
- address
- bc1qulfszlkwjrujwj4lcfjafswfcdlxlv7w55vzxr